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Linux kernel versions prior to 4.5.3
Description
The issue is related to the
usbip recv xbuff function in the Linux kernel, which can be exploited by rem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ds write) or possibly have other unspecified impacts. This is achieved by sending a crafted length value in a USB/IP packet.Recommendations
For Linux kernel versions prior to 4.5.3, update to version 4.5.3 or later to resolve the issue.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to the
usbip recv xbuff function to minimize the risk of exploitation.Exploit
